Biography of P Diddy

Sean John Combs, better known by his stage name P Diddy, is a renowned American rapper, record producer, and entrepreneur. Born on November 4, 1969, in Harlem, New York City, Combs has made a significant impact on the music industry and beyond. His journey from a humble beginning to becoming a global icon is a testament to his talent, determination, and business acumen.

P Diddy's early life was marked by challenges and opportunities that shaped his future. Raised by his mother after the tragic murder of his father, Combs attended Howard University, where he majored in business. Although he didn't complete his degree, his time at Howard was pivotal in honing his skills and networking abilities.

Combs' career took off in the early 1990s when he founded Bad Boy Records, a label that would become synonymous with the rise of hip hop. His ability to spot and nurture talent led to the success of artists like The Notorious B.I.G., Faith Evans, and Mase. With multiple Grammy Awards to his name and a list of chart-topping hits, P Diddy has established himself as a force to be reckoned with in the music industry.

Beyond music, P Diddy has ventured into various business endeavors, including fashion, beverages, and media. His Sean John clothing line has won accolades, and his collaboration with Ciroc vodka has proven to be highly profitable. P Diddy's entrepreneurial spirit has earned him a place among the wealthiest figures in the entertainment world.

The Legacy of "Shawshank Redemption"

"Shawshank Redemption," directed by Frank Darabont and based on Stephen King's novella "Rita Hayworth and Shawshank Redemption," was released in 1994. Despite its initial lukewarm box-office performance, the film has since gained a cult following and is now regarded as one of the greatest films ever made. Its enduring appeal lies in its powerful storytelling, compelling performances, and themes of hope, friendship, and redemption.

Set in the 1940s, the film follows the story of Andy Dufresne, a banker who is wrongfully imprisoned for the murder of his wife and her lover. Inside Shawshank State Penitentiary, Andy befriends Ellis "Red" Redding, played by Morgan Freeman, and together they navigate the harsh realities of prison life. Through Andy's resilience and ingenuity, the film explores the triumph of the human spirit in the face of adversity.

The film's success can be attributed to its exceptional cast, led by Tim Robbins and Morgan Freeman, who delivered performances that resonated with audiences worldwide. The screenplay, adapted by Darabont, stayed true to King's original vision while adding depth and nuance to the characters and their stories.

The Role of Music in "Shawshank Redemption"

The role of music in "Shawshank Redemption" is a crucial element of the film's storytelling, as it serves to enhance the emotional impact of key scenes and underscore the film's themes of hope and redemption. The film's score, composed by Thomas Newman, is a masterful blend of orchestral and ambient elements that evoke a sense of longing, hope, and transcendence.

One of the most iconic musical moments in the film occurs when Andy Dufresne plays a recording of Mozart's "The Marriage of Figaro" over the prison's PA system. This scene is a powerful expression of the transformative power of music, as it offers a moment of beauty and freedom to the inmates of Shawshank.

The film's score also plays a crucial role in conveying the emotions of the characters and the overarching themes of the story. Newman's use of recurring motifs and themes throughout the film creates a sense of continuity and cohesion, underscoring the film's message of hope and resilience.
